March 2, 2022

Вакансия QA Engineer в СберОбразовании

СберОбразование — компания экосистемы Сбера.

Мы — новая компания (образована весной 2021 года) и наша команда находится в стадии активного формирования.

Сейчас мы ищем QA Engineer (automated testing).

О проектах:

Основа наших продуктов — цифровая образовательная платформа, которую мы продолжаем развивать и совершенствовать, а вместе с ней и наши проекты:

СберКласс — цифровое решение, направленное на персонализацию образования в школах.

В рамках этого проекта мы реализовываем инструменты, которые сделают образовательный процесс увлекательным, гибким и направленным на индивидуальные потребности и особенности ученика (система адаптивного обучения на основе AI, геймифицированные задания и тренажеры и пр.). СберКласс успешно применяется в нескольких тысячах российских школ. В наших планах — подключение к СберКлассу не менее 25% школ страны.

Чтобы узнать больше, можно ознакомиться с демо-версией продукта и посмотреть интервью с Артёмом, Product-manager'ом Сберкласса.

СберКласс Лайт — решение для школ, которые пока не готовы полностью переходить на персонализированную модель образования. К его разработке мы только приступаем.

"СберОбразование" —находящееся в разработке решение для непрерывного образования взрослых. Наработки из него уже активно используются во внутренних проектах Сбера.

Что предстоит делать:

  • Принимать решения о том, что, когда и как тестировать (а также, кому тестировать);
  • Разрабатывать тестовые сценарии для эффективного покрытия требований;
  • Оценивать степень соответствия требованиям;
  • Находить дефекты и давать оценку качества системы;
  • Тестировать руками, а точнее головой (исследовательское тестирование, анализ требований);
  • Автоматизировать повторяющиеся тесты.

О задачах:

На ближайшее время:

  • Анализ функциональных и нефункциональных требований к продукту;
  • Выбор технологий и инструментария автоматизации (у нас уже есть Playwright, CodecptJS, Appium, jUnit);
  • Написание сценариев API и UI тестов для проверки бизнес-требований.

На первый год работы:

  • Покрытие продукта функциональными тестами, выполняемыми в автоматизированном режиме;
  • Исследовательское тестирование требований и готового продукта, воспроизведение ошибок, обнаруженных пользователями (здесь нам помогут Sentry, Crashlytics/FireBase);
  • Настройка, запуск и контроль выполнения нефункциональных тестов (используя GitLab Web API Fuzz Testing, сканеры уязвимостей и генераторы нагрузки).

Команда:

Мы формируем команды полного цикла, в составе которых, как правило до 10 сотрудников (teamlead, frontend, backend, QA, analyst, product owner). Собирая команду и определяя задачи для нее, мы ориентируемся на экспертизу ее участников.

О требованиях:

Мы хотели бы, чтобы наш будущий коллега обладал:

  • Знанием теории тестирования;
  • Навыками программирования;
  • Знаниями технологий в основе "облачных" информационных систем (web, API, клиент-серверная архитектура);
  • Пониманием процесса и основ методологий разработки информационных систем и места QA в них.

Будет плюсом:

  • Опыт работы с CodeceptJS и JavaScript;
  • Опыт автоматизированного, нагрузочного, тестирования API, информационной безопасности;
  • Умение настраивать запуск тестов в рамках CI/CD, получать отчеты в Allure.

Об условиях:

В рамках этой позиции мы предлагаем:

  • Высокую и полностью белую заработную плату (сейчас мы готовы быть гибкими и ориентируемся на ваши ожидания по ЗП);
  • ДМС со стоматологией с первой недели работы;
  • Гибридный формат работы с гибким началом рабочего дня;
  • Возможность длительной удаленной работы;
  • Дополнительное премирование согласно внутренним положениям компании;
  • Другие бенефиты, которые мы предложим на основе вашего выбора (изучение английского языка, спорт и пр.), пакет формируется.

Если вы узнали себя в вакансии - смело пишите [email protected] или в Telegram, будем рады пообщаться!